The formula for area of a circle is pi*r^2. If the radius is 20, what is the area?

Respuesta :

lilamarlin lilamarlin
  • 18-03-2022

Answer:

area of circle = πr^2

just substitute 20 for r:

π(20)^2

= 400π

If the question ask for an answer in terms of pi, this is your answer. If it doesn't, simplify it further to get:

= 1256.637061 (m/cm)^2

You can round this however you like, but I would say either 3 significant figures, either 1 or 2 decimal places.
